Crown Colonies in question.

It appears unreasonable thus to penalise Colonies

which freely admit French goods, and it would be a

great service to us if the French Government could be

induced to withdraw its decision imposing the higher

duties upon cargo transhipped, especially, at Hong Kong.

Failing this, we should be glad if it could be ar-

ranged that we should be given the advantage of a regu-

lation of the French Customs, which waives the higher

duties in case of transhipment, at Hong Kong for ex-

smple, from an "accessory" Line of the same steamship

This advantage is at present refused to us

Company.

on the ground that the voyage from Vancouver to Hong-

Kong is too long for our service of steamers on that

route to be regarded as an accessory Line.

We are, &c.,

(Signed)

Alfred Holt and Company.
